Output 829a32c820f8b74d0c7757382ee83a530a180e582820bbe588601fc238e9a695:37

value
78735
script pubkey
OP_HASH160 OP_PUSHBYTES_20 afba6abb8ad592a977106250c05586014dfd585d OP_EQUAL
address
3HiBVb7nZ184TehmenbHQf4c94VygJZDUg
transaction
829a32c820f8b74d0c7757382ee83a530a180e582820bbe588601fc238e9a695
confirmations
235674
spent
true